The 2020–21 season is Guadalajara's fourth competitive season and fourth season in the Liga MX Femenil, the top flight of Mexican women's football.

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Liga MX Femenil's start was delayed for August 2020.[1]
On 23 July 2020, manager Ramón Villa Zevallos was fired due to differences between him and the club's management, regarding the "players' development".[2] He was replaced by Édgar Mejía, who previously played for Guadalajara and achieved a league championship in 2006.[3]
